Employment in Qatar operates under the kafala sponsorship framework, where most foreign workers require an employer sponsor to obtain a residence permit. Hiring typically proceeds through documented applications, references, and contract review before arrival. Employers commonly request educational credentials, professional certifications, and work history verification. Contracts specify job title, salary, benefits, and duration—commonly fixed-term arrangements ranging from one to three years. Working hours generally follow a standard schedule, though sector and employer policies vary. Eligibility depends on nationality, qualifications, and the employer's sector. The working year runs calendar January to December, with annual leave entitlements typically accruing throughout the year and concentrated around national holidays.
